Originální abstrakt

Tensile tests of an unalloyed ADI with the matrix created by upper bainite containing from 30 to 35 % of retained austenite were performed in a temperature range -196 to +200 C. The temperature dependence of true fracture stress, elongation to fracture, and reduction in area is separated into three regions. Unmonotonous temperature dependence of yield points defined by plastic strain from 0.05 to 2 % in the middle region is the evidence of the stress induced phase transformation of retained austenite into martensite before these values of plastic strain are reached.
